C语言学习利器

出版时间:2007-4  出版社:水利水电  作者:钟民 毛敏莉  页数:350  
Tag标签:无  

内容概要

  《C语言学习利器:AI-CODE坦克机器人》是“万水编程革命系列”的第一本,把机器人设计与C语言巧妙结合起来,让读者在躲避子弹、前进后退及与对手作战中全面掌握C语言的变量、函数、数组、指针、头文件、结构体、文件流、模块化编程等各个要素。《C语言学习利器:AI-CODE坦克机器人》从浅入深,侧重于C语言的特性与机器人代码实现。随着C语言水平和机器人策略能力的提高,在最后《C语言学习利器:AI-CODE坦克机器人》还介绍了人工智能及一些极具创意的机器人的设计。  《C语言学习利器:AI-CODE坦克机器人》章节设计合理,符合人脑思维定式,使读者更易掌握各个知识点。首先定出章节学习目标与任务,其次分析任务,穿插C语言知识与机器人策略,并用代码实现,然后在任务的基础上进行知识点扩展,最后对章节总结要点并给出练习。  《C语言学习利器:AI-CODE坦克机器人》是编程爱好者、大中专学生加快学习的福音,更是计算机老师教学的强有力工具。《C语言学习利器:AI-CODE坦克机器人》可作为高等院校、高职高专、培训机构的教材。目前,AI-CODE已经被部分大学作为教学辅助软件使用。AI-CODE必将改变传统教学,引领新的编程革命。

书籍目录

前言第一部分 基础篇第1章 C平台与Al-CODE概述1.1 教育理念1.1.1 传统教育1.1.2 游戏教育理念1.1.3 游戏化学习1.2 机器人编程游戏历史。1.2.1 AI.CODE的诞生及发展1.2.2 AI-CODE游戏教育系统简介1.2.3 AI.CODE两大主题1.3 程序和算法1.3.1 结构化程序设计方法1.3.2 C语言简介及起源1.3.3 C语言概述1.3.4 C平台和环境说明1.3.5 C与C++语言的异同1.4 快速体验1.4.1 下载并安装AI-CODE1.4.2 快乐竞技之旅1.4.3 虚拟机器人运作平台——AIRobot1.4.4 图形编辑器——机器人快车1.4.5代码编辑器——CodeCanvas第2章 Al-CODE的数学与物理知识2.1 数学知识2.1.1 坐标系统2.1.2 三角几何学与方向2.1.3 离散数学2.1.4 数学函数2.2 物理知识2.2.1 机器人解剖2.2.2 机器人速度、距离、力2.2.3 子弹能量、热、速度2.2.4 F0rce与动量守恒定理2.3 基本参数2.3.1 系统时钟2.3.2 其他辅助参数第3章 图形编程——快速步入程序之门3.1 学习目标与任务3.2 机器人快车概述3.2.1 机器人快车的安装与卸载3.2.2 机器人快车简介3.2.3 流程模块拖拉编程3.3 向战场中央靠拢机器人3.4 机器人快车函数封装3.5 小结与练习第4章 我的第一个C机器人4.1 学习目标与任务4.2 编辑、编译、运行C机器人4.3 机器人开发4.3.1 AI-CODE开发目录设置4.3.2 创建First机器人4.3.3 机器人名称与C头文件4.4 FirstRobot结构解析4.4.1 Action与onTick处理函数4.4.2 常用函数4.5 AI-TANK常用头文件4.6 知识扩展4.6.1 C源程序的结构特点4.6.2 经典例子机器人说明4.7 小结与练习第二部分 中级篇第5章 基本运动与C语言基础5.1 学习目标与任务5.2 基本运动策略5.3 直线运动与C基本语法5.3.1 运动原理分析……第6章 基本瞄准与函数第三部分 高级篇第7章 战争情报员与数组第8章 指针实现避弹避墙第9章 高级机器人与结构体第10章 战略合成、模块化与预处理第11章 机器人异常调试与Record机器人第12章 团队作战的实现第13章 高级调试与绘图机器人第四部分 专家篇第14章 智能机器人第15章 联赛系统、XML与内部机制第16章 AI-CODE外传附录1 章节机器人对照表附录2 知识点参考文献

图书封面

图书标签Tags

评论、评分、阅读与下载


    C语言学习利器 PDF格式下载


用户评论 (总计0条)

 
 

 

250万本中文图书简介、评论、评分,PDF格式免费下载。 第一图书网 手机版

京ICP备13047387号-7